Tim Spector visits Google to discuss his book \\u201cFood for Life: The New Science of Eating Well\\u201d, an easy-to-follow guide on how to eat\\u2014for our health and the health of the planet.

Tim\\u2019s book reveals a new approach to nutrition, encouraging us to forget misleading calorie counts and nutritional breakdowns. In \\u201cFood for Life\\u201d, he draws on over a decade of cutting-edge scientific research, along with his own personal insights, to deliver a new and comprehensive approach to what we should all know about food today.

Investigating everything from environmental impact and food fraud to allergies and deceptive labeling, Spector also shows us the many wondrous and surprising properties of everyday foods, which scientists are only just beginning to understand.

Tim Spector is a professor of genetic epidemiology at King\'s College London. He is a multi-award-winning expert in personalized medicine and the gut microbiome, and the author of five books, including the bestsellers \\u201cSpoon-Fed\\u201d and \\u201cThe Diet Myth\\u201d. He appears regularly on TV, radio and podcasts around the world, and is one of the top 100 most cited scientists in the world.
